What is the buzz about “Trump Turn Off the Lights”?

In February 2016, during his campaign speech (for president of the United States of America) at the Georgia World Congress Center in Atlanta, Georgia, the crowd to Chant multiple times ‘Turn Off the Lights’. Because the lights get cut off mid-sentence on Donald Trump. So, that creates some tensions and questions around it, about who turned the lights off in the middle of his campaign speech (for the president of the United States in 2016).

Trump Turn Off the Lights

Donald Trump repeats multiple times “Get those lights off”. And encourages the people to shout out loud “Turn Off the Lights”. And then suddenly the lights go off in this crowded room. And the crowd screams from happy after that action.
